#include <stdio.h> #include <ctype.h> int main() { char letter = 'a'; isalpha(letter); /* 是字母返回非0,否则返回0*/ isupper(letter); /* 是大写字母返回非0,否则返回0*/ islower(letter); /* 是小写字母返回非0,否则返回0*/ isdigit(letter); /* 是数字返回非0,否则返回0*/ isalnum(letter); /* 是数字或字母返回非0,否则返回0*/ /* 是空格、横向制表符、换行符、回车符、换页符、纵向制表符返回非0,否则返回0*/ isspace(letter); toupper(letter); /* 返回大写 */ tolower(letter); /* 返回小写 */ return 0; }
|
|
来自: 海漩涡 > 《C_programming_language》